Book excerpt: The study reviews the recent history of public finance mismanagement and its adverse impact on Somalia, drawing upon five decades of economic and financial mismanagement in the country. A principal thesis of the study is that, while decades-long poor sociopolitical governance and multiple other factors contributed to the implosion of the Somali central state, a crisis in financial and economic management-in particular, endemic misuse of public resoruces-is a root cause of the state collapse and a principal challenge facing national recovery. This crisis, manifested in practically non-existent financial integrity institutions, keeps the country insecure and unstable.
